L'Oreal Paris Sublime Bronze Tinted Self Tanning Lotion Review: Achieve a Sun-Kissed Glow?

Achieving a natural-looking tan without the harmful effects of sun exposure is a desire shared by many. Self-tanning lotions offer a convenient alternative, and L'Oreal Paris Sublime Bronze Tinted Self Tanning Lotion, in Medium Natural Tan, promises a streak-free, believable bronze. But does it deliver on its promises? This in-depth review will explore its features, performance, and suitability for different skin types to help you decide if it's the right self-tanner for you. This review covers the 5 fl. Oz bottle.

This product is ideal for those seeking a gradual, natural-looking tan. It’s designed for everyday use, allowing you to build color gradually over several applications rather than achieving a deep tan instantly. Individuals with fair to medium skin tones will find this lotion particularly suitable. Those with darker skin tones might find the Medium Natural shade too light.

Key Features of L'Oreal Paris Sublime Bronze Tinted Self Tanning Lotion

  • Tinted Formula: Allows for easy application and helps to avoid streaks and unevenness, enabling you to see where you are applying the product.
  • Medium Natural Tan: Suitable for fair to medium skin tones, providing a gradual, buildable tan.
  • Lightweight and Non-Greasy: Absorbs quickly into the skin without leaving a sticky or oily residue.
  • 5 fl. oz Bottle: Provides sufficient product for several applications, depending on your usage.
  • Hydrating Formula: Contains moisturizing ingredients that help to keep your skin hydrated and soft.

Pros: What We Loved About L'Oreal Sublime Bronze

  • Easy Application: The tinted formula makes application effortless. You can easily see where you've applied the lotion, preventing missed patches and streaks. It blends seamlessly into the skin, giving a very even finish. This is a significant improvement over many self-tanners which can be notoriously difficult to apply evenly.
  • Natural-Looking Tan: The resulting tan is subtle and buildable, offering a natural-looking glow rather than an overly orange or fake-looking finish. This is key for many users wanting a sun-kissed look rather than a deep, intense tan.
  • Hydrating: Unlike some self-tanners that can dry out the skin, this lotion contains hydrating ingredients that leave skin feeling soft and supple. This is a massive advantage, especially for those with dry skin. This improves the overall user experience.

Cons: Areas for Improvement

  • Limited Shade Range: The limited shade range might not cater to all skin tones. Those with deeper skin complexions might find the “Medium Natural” shade too light and needing a darker alternative.
  • Faint Smell: While not overpowering, some users might find the subtle self-tanner scent slightly unpleasant. However, it’s not as strong or artificial as some competitor products.

Comparison with Competitors

Compared to other self-tanners like Jergens Natural Glow and St. Tropez Self Tan, L'Oreal Paris Sublime Bronze offers a more affordable price point while maintaining a good level of quality and ease of use. While St. Tropez might provide a more intense tan, it often comes with a higher price tag and requires more expertise in application. Jergens offers a similar level of ease of use but might not deliver the same natural-looking results. The choice depends on your budget and desired level of tan.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How long does the tan last?

A: The tan typically lasts for several days, depending on your skin type and how often you exfoliate.

Q: Can I use this on my face?

A: It's generally recommended to avoid using this product on your face, as it may clog pores. Use a dedicated facial self-tanner instead.

Q: How often should I apply it?

A: You can apply it daily or every other day, depending on your desired level of tan and skin tone.
